Transaction c6dbfe86d4bbdd5f9aa88fa03b90dd263b238e5a97e45fae1c06ddd00a8c4751

block
3dfae42f745612402bbcaf9ba48ffe5b886d438b5c51c7542f79fef8ce4e0410

1 Input

23 Outputs